Patent number: 11816601Abstract: A computerized operation of a vehicle rental system is provided, wherein a number of vehicles is made available to a defined user group for a temporary use period. The vehicles are placed at one or more locations accessible only to the user group, with one or multiple parking spaces reserved for the vehicles in each case. Based on a user input which includes at least one item of data regarding a rental period start and a rental period end of a vehicle, as well as a user ID, a reservation of the vehicle is carried out in a computerized reservation system. A sensor device, which monitors the parking spaces, verifies the presence of the vehicle. The reservation system shows a vehicle, the same being detected by the sensor device as parked in one of the reserved parking spaces prior to the expiration of the rental period end and saved in the reservation system, as available for rental in the reservation system.Type: GrantFiled: February 4, 2014Date of Patent: November 14, 2023Assignee: Bayerische Motoren Werke AktiengesellschaftInventor: Astrid Schroeder

Patent number: 11277741Abstract: An at least partly autonomous vehicle includes a communication interface configured for vehicle-external communication, a memory configured to store at least one piece of authentication information, and a control unit configured to control the communication interface and to output the authentication information from the memory via the communication interface when the control unit receives an instruction for outputting the authentication information.Type: GrantFiled: September 13, 2019Date of Patent: March 15, 2022Assignee: Bayerische Motoren Werke AktiengesellschaftInventor: Astrid Schroeder

Patent number: 9694767Abstract: A configuration system of a vehicle has at least one functional unit, a control unit pertaining to the functional unit, and a parametrizing unit provided in the vehicle, which is operatively connected with the control unit. The configuring system includes a storage device which can be read out by the parametrizing unit and which contains configuration information for the control unit, by which configuration information a parametrizing of the control unit can be carried out. The storage device additionally contains configuration information for the vehicle, in which case the storage device contains evaluation rules by which the parametrizing unit can determine configuration information for the configuration of the control unit from the configuration information for the vehicle and the configuration information for the control unit and can configure the control unit.Type: GrantFiled: October 25, 2007Date of Patent: July 4, 2017Assignee: Bayerische Motoren Werke AktiengesellschaftInventors: Christian Suess, Astrid Schroeder

Patent number: 9286244Abstract: A method and a device for monitoring an unauthorized memory access to a predetermined memory area in a computing device are described, in which a monitoring medium is provided, having at least one sensor medium, which is set up for the purpose of recognizing an event of the computing device, and at least one recognition medium, which is set up for the purpose of tracking the behavior of the event recognized by the sensor medium, the monitoring medium being integrated into a sequence pattern on the computing device, and the monitoring medium being set up for the purpose of monitoring the sequence pattern at its runtime, in that memory accesses to a memory address or an address range are detected by the monitoring medium as events.Type: GrantFiled: December 20, 2007Date of Patent: March 15, 2016Assignee: Bayerische Motoren Werke AktiengesellschaftInventors: Thomas Stauner, Astrid Schroeder, Martin E. Thiede

Publication number: 20130080196Abstract: A process is provided for computer-aided operation of a mobility service by which a number of vehicles are made available by a mobility provider to registered users for temporary use. A respective user is registered once in a booking system as a provider and/or a buyer of a mobility service feature. A first user registered as a provider reserves the vehicle for a period of time in the booking system. The first user further clears the use of a mobility service feature for a second user connected with the vehicle booking whereby the mobility service feature for the second user is offered for selection. An accounting of costs for the vehicle booking takes place as a function of whether at least one second user was determined as a buyer of the provided mobility service feature.Type: ApplicationFiled: August 3, 2012Publication date: March 28, 2013Applicant: Bayerische Motoren Werke AktiengesellschaftInventors: Astrid SCHROEDER, Heleen Borghols-Wilmink, Marco Eggert

Patent number: 7283902Abstract: A method is provided for transferring at least a first personal setting of a first vehicle to a second vehicle, especially for a driver, who changes the vehicle. To transfer the vehicle settings that are known to the driver as true to the original as possible from a first vehicle to a second vehicle, thus without falsifying the subjective impression, first personalization data indicating the personal first setting is exported from the first vehicle in the original form or in a modified form in a first step and is imported into the second vehicle in a second step. The second personalization data are formed based on the imported data; and a personal setting is carried out with the second personalization data in the second vehicle, wherein the model and/or the accessories of the first and second vehicle may be identical or different.Type: GrantFiled: July 14, 2006Date of Patent: October 16, 2007Assignee: Bayerische Motoren Werke AktiengesellschaftInventors: Andreas Heider, Thomas Stauner, Alexandre Saad, Astrid Schroeder
